加入收藏 | 设为首页 | 会员中心 | 我要投稿 PHP编程网 - 湛江站长网 (https://www.0759zz.com/)- 机器学习、视觉智能、智能搜索、语音技术、决策智能!
当前位置: 首页 > 教程 > 正文

MySQL进阶:数据库管理员高效运维全攻略

发布时间:2025-11-26 14:54:22 所属栏目:教程 来源:DaWei
导读:  作为内链优化师,深知数据库在网站性能中的关键作用。MySQL作为广泛应用的关系型数据库,其高效运维对系统稳定性至关重要。数据库管理员需要掌握进阶技巧,才能应对复杂场景。  索引是提升查询效率的核心手段。

  作为内链优化师,深知数据库在网站性能中的关键作用。MySQL作为广泛应用的关系型数据库,其高效运维对系统稳定性至关重要。数据库管理员需要掌握进阶技巧,才能应对复杂场景。


  索引是提升查询效率的核心手段。合理设计索引结构,避免全表扫描,能显著降低响应时间。同时需注意索引的维护成本,避免过度索引导致写入性能下降。


  慢查询日志是诊断性能瓶颈的重要工具。通过分析日志,可以识别执行时间长的SQL语句,并进行优化。定期清理和归档日志文件,有助于保持系统整洁。


  事务管理直接影响数据一致性与并发控制。合理设置事务隔离级别,减少锁竞争,避免死锁问题。使用BEGIN、COMMIT等语句规范事务操作,确保数据完整性。


  备份与恢复策略是运维工作的基础。制定完善的备份计划,包括全量与增量备份,确保在故障发生时能够快速恢复数据。测试恢复流程,验证备份有效性。


  监控系统资源使用情况,如CPU、内存、磁盘I/O等,有助于提前发现潜在问题。利用工具如MySQL Enterprise Monitor或Prometheus,实时跟踪数据库状态。


  配置调优也是提升性能的关键。调整缓冲池大小、连接数限制等参数,根据实际负载进行优化。避免默认配置带来的性能损耗。


2025AI绘图,仅供参考

  安全防护不可忽视。设置强密码策略,限制远程访问权限,定期更新数据库版本,防止已知漏洞被利用。启用SSL加密传输,保障数据安全。

(编辑:PHP编程网 - 湛江站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章